CourseDetails
โข Site Analysis: Understanding the physical and social context of a community space, including existing land use, transportation, infrastructure, and demographics.
โข Community Engagement: Techniques for involving community members in the planning and design process, including outreach, workshops, and surveys.
โข Space Programming: Identifying the needs and functions of a community space, including uses, activities, and user groups.
โข Site Design: Creating functional and aesthetically pleasing designs for community spaces, including layout, circulation, and landscaping.
โข Sustainable Design: Incorporating sustainable principles and practices into community space design, including materials, energy efficiency, and water conservation.
โข Accessibility: Ensuring community spaces are accessible and inclusive for people of all ages and abilities, including compliance with the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A).
โข Implementation and Management: Strategies for implementing and managing community spaces, including funding, maintenance, and programming.
โข Evaluation and Assessment: Measuring the impact and effectiveness of community spaces, including data collection, analysis, and reporting.
